The Trezor Wallet is a popular hardware wallet designed to provide secure storage for cryptocurrencies. Trezor is known for its emphasis on security, user-friendly design, and support for a wide range of cryptocurrencies. Below are key aspects and features of the Trezor Wallet:

Trezor Wallet Overview:

1. Hardware Security:

  • Offline Storage: Trezor keeps private keys offline on the hardware device, reducing the risk of exposure to online threats like hacking or malware.

  • Secure Element: The device uses a secure element chip to enhance the security of cryptographic operations.

2. Device Models:

  • Trezor One: The original Trezor model featuring a small screen and physical buttons.

  • Trezor Model T: An upgraded version with a color touchscreen interface for improved user experience.

3. Supported Cryptocurrencies:

  • Diverse Range: Trezor supports a wide variety of cryptocurrencies, including major ones like Bitcoin (BTC), Ethereum (ETH), Litecoin (LTC), and various ERC-20 tokens.

  • Regularly Updated: The list of supported cryptocurrencies is regularly expanded through firmware updates.

4. Security Features:

  • PIN Protection: Users set up a PIN code on the Trezor device to secure access to the wallet.

  • Passphrase Support: Users have the option to set up an additional passphrase for added security, creating hidden wallets.

5. Ease of Use:

  • User-Friendly Interface: Trezor devices have an intuitive interface, allowing users to navigate through menus and confirm transactions directly on the device.

6. Recovery Seed:

  • Backup Phrase: During the initial setup, users are provided with a recovery seed (backup phrase) that can be used to restore access to funds if the device is lost or damaged.

7. Integration with Wallets:

  • Trezor Wallet Interface: Trezor provides its official wallet interface where users can manage their cryptocurrency holdings.

  • Third-Party Wallets: Users can also use third-party wallets, such as Electrum, with Trezor integration.

8. Firmware Updates:

  • Security Enhancements: Trezor devices receive firmware updates to improve security features, add support for new cryptocurrencies, and enhance overall functionality.

9. Security Standards:

  • Open Source: Trezor's firmware is open source, allowing the community to review and contribute to its development.

  • Security Audits: Trezor has undergone third-party security audits to ensure its robustness.
